Output 93af9a2177b5c3c84c58a424bd35221231fdae3e5361fd69660c1513a02a3e21:0

value
3780566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75f168aee360c029eeb0b0ab33d997a76bc9b256 OP_EQUAL
address
3CSeBNd9ye8rD6Yy5X5yYjqs1fa5eoy6ni
transaction
93af9a2177b5c3c84c58a424bd35221231fdae3e5361fd69660c1513a02a3e21
spent
true